Review: Ultex Jazz 3 Picks

Ahhhhh, the sweet taste of victory. When you have looked so long for a
pick this good, and it just jumps out at you one day. The Ultex Jazz 3
picks are perhaps the best soloing pick every. I was able to shred
through arpeggios like no other pick allowed, without worrying about
my pick moving around everywhere. The reason? Ultex
Jazz 3's are so light, i forgot I had it in my hand! It doesnt slip
everywhere when you sweat like a Jazz 3 Stiffo does. It stay in one
place, and it wont move unless you move it. It strums the strings like
butter, with every pick being clean and precise (unless you cant pick,
but dont blame it in the pick)
and it works like a charm for sweep picking. Sure it doesn't come in
any fancy colors, and just say JIM DUNLOP on one side and ULTEX JAZZ
III on the other, but if you want a pick to shred with this is a good
pick to try. Oh, and pinch harmonic work nicely. Conclusion: if you
play somethjng that demands speed and accuracy, these picks wont let
you down.
